Salad — calories at a glance
Ordering a salad feels like the low-calorie move, but the menu's salads are only as light as their toppings. The greens themselves are nearly free — under 20 calories for a full serving of supergreens — while dressing, cheese, sour cream and guacamole can quietly stack 700 calories on top. Ingredient by ingredient — calories, fat, carbs, protein, sodium
| Ingredient | Portion | Calories | Fat | Carbs | Protein | Sodium |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Supergreens Salad Mix | 3 oz | 15 calories | 0g fat | 3g carbs | 1g protein | 15mg sodium |
| Romaine Lettuce | 1 oz | 5 calories | 0g fat | 1g carbs | 0g protein | 0mg sodium |
| Fajita Vegetables | 2 oz | 20 calories | 0g fat | 5g carbs | 1g protein | 150mg sodium |
| Barbacoa | 4 oz | 170 calories | 7g fat | 2g carbs | 24g protein | 530mg sodium |
| Chicken | 4 oz | 180 calories | 7g fat | 0g carbs | 32g protein | 310mg sodium |
| Carnitas | 4 oz | 210 calories | 12g fat | 0g carbs | 23g protein | 450mg sodium |
| Steak | 4 oz | 150 calories | 6g fat | 1g carbs | 21g protein | 330mg sodium |
| Sofritas | 4 oz | 150 calories | 10g fat | 9g carbs | 8g protein | 560mg sodium |
| Fresh Tomato Salsa | 4 oz | 25 calories | 0g fat | 4g carbs | 0g protein | 550mg sodium |
| Roasted Chili-Corn Salsa | 4 oz | 80 calories | 1.5g fat | 16g carbs | 3g protein | 330mg sodium |
| Tomatillo-Green Chili Salsa | 2 fl oz | 15 calories | 0g fat | 4g carbs | 0g protein | 260mg sodium |
| Tomatillo-Red Chili Salsa | 2 fl oz | 30 calories | 0g fat | 4g carbs | 0g protein | 500mg sodium |
| Cheese | 1 oz | 110 calories | 8g fat | 1g carbs | 6g protein | 190mg sodium |
| Sour Cream | 2 oz | 110 calories | 9g fat | 2g carbs | 2g protein | 30mg sodium |
| Guacamole | 4 oz | 230 calories | 22g fat | 8g carbs | 2g protein | 370mg sodium |
| Queso Blanco | 2 oz | 120 calories | 9g fat | 4g carbs | 5g protein | 250mg sodium |
| Chipotle-Honey Vinaigrette | 2 fl oz | 220 calories | 16g fat | 18g carbs | 1g protein | 850mg sodium |
What moves the numbers
- The salad base (supergreens or romaine) costs almost nothing calorically — every meaningful number comes from what you put on it.
- Chipotle-honey vinaigrette is the most concentrated topping per serving — sweetened dressings add up faster than salsas.
- Chicken or steak keeps the salad high-protein and lean; carnitas and barbacoa roughly double the fat contribution.
- Two full servings of toppings (cheese + sour cream + guac) can exceed the calorie count of a modest burrito.
Salad FAQ
How many calories are in a salad?
A bare chicken salad with salsa is around 420 calories. The same salad with cheese, sour cream, guacamole and vinaigrette climbs past 1,000. Build yours above.
What's the healthiest salad build?
Supergreens base, chicken or steak, fajita vegetables, fresh tomato salsa, and either guacamole or vinaigrette — not both. That keeps you near 600 calories with 40+ g of protein.
Is the vinaigrette or guacamole better?
Guacamole has more calories but brings fiber and healthy fats; the vinaigrette is lighter per serving but mostly oil and sugar. Pick one, not both.
